On Wed, 2005-03-02 at 00:36 +0200, Olav Kongas wrote: > Therefore I suspect that the dongle is guilty sending the > USB data packet with incorrect Toggle from EP3 every now and > then. Say, when you start a new operation like ping. Of > course, the verification would be to detect this error with > some other HC and HCD or with USB analyzer. As the error > condition is temporary, I think we may stop here.
the latest bk revision of drivers/net/usb/pegasus.c seems to agree with you. From the changelog - Stop log spamming ... at least some of these chips seem to get confused about data toggle, no point in warning about each packet error as it's detected. I also asked one of my colleagues to try the dongle on another of our boards with an OHCI controller and we saw EP3 toggle errors there as well. > In summary, I have tried hard to convince the world and > myself that somebody else is guilty of this error :) Thanks > for your help.
